A 1967 Fender Telecaster guitar in red with a white scratchplate. The guitar has a long and interesting history having been used by various musicians including Lee Brilleaux (Dr Feelgood), Roman Jugg (The Damned), Warren Kennedy (Eddie & The Hot Rods), Peter Perett (The Only Ones) and Neil Hannon (Divine Comedy). Whilst in the possession of Neil Hannon the guitar was used on multiple tours and featured on the albums 'Regeneration' and 'Absent Friends'. The guitar can be seen on YouTube being played by Neil at The London Palladium on the song 'Something For The Weekend'. A fitted hard carry case is supplied with the guitar.
